Roxy ★ 4.4
€€stare-mestoShow-dependent, club nights typically 22:00 to late
Roxy occupies a vaulted Old Town cellar on Dlouhá and has booked Prague's longest-running electronic music programme since 1992, alongside live indie and rock shows in a four-bar room beneath medieval brick arches. Bookings run from local residents to international touring DJs.
Tip: Tickets on GoOut; the queue moves fastest before midnight. The NoD theatre upstairs runs separate programming.
AghaRTA Jazz Centrum ★ 4.3
€stare-mestoDaily 19:00-01:00, concert 21:00
AghaRTA runs an Old Town basement off Železná with vaulted ceilings and a low stage that puts the band a metre from the front row. The programme has booked Czech and international jazz, fusion and world acts every night since 1991 and runs its own record label.
Tip: Sets start at 21:00; arrive by 20:30 for seats. The phone line takes bookings evenings only.
Jazz Republic ★ 4.2
€stare-mestoDaily 20:00-00:00, Tuesday from 22:00
Jazz Republic has run nightly sets since 1997 in a vaulted cellar off Jilská near the Old Town Square, programming Czech and international jazz, blues, fusion and Latin acts in a 50-seat room. Capacity is small enough that the front row sits at the band's feet.
Tip: Reservations cap group bookings at 10; cash door. The Tuesday slot opens later than the rest of the week.
Terasa U Prince ★ 4.0
€€€stare-mestoDaily 09:00-23:30
Terasa U Prince runs on the fifth-floor roof of Hotel U Prince on the Old Town Square, with a wraparound terrace directly opposite the Astronomical Clock and the towers of Týn Church. The bar serves cocktails, grilled plates and wine from morning to late evening.
Tip: The Astronomical Clock view is the seat to ask for; arrive on the hour for the procession of the apostles. Lift from the hotel lobby.
Hemingway Bar ★ 4.7
€€€stare-mestoMon-Thu 17:00-01:00, Fri-Sat 17:00-02:00, Sun 17:00-01:00
Hemingway Bar relocated in May 2025 from Karoliny Světlé to Opatovická 3 and opened with a 1930s-style room, leather banquettes, a marble counter and a 200-rum back bar. The cocktail list pairs classic builds with absinthe and rum riffs; the bar reached number 24 on the World's 50 Best Bars list in 2014.
Tip: Book ahead via the site; small room turns over twice in a night. The signature Hemingway Paparazzi pairs Havana 7 with Becherovka.
Black Angel's Bar ★ 4.5
€€€stare-mestoDaily 19:00-03:00
Black Angel's runs in the medieval vaulted cellar beneath Hotel U Prince on the Old Town Square, with low-lit booths under brick arches and a list of classic and house cocktails poured by tail-coated bartenders. The room has ranked among the Tales of the Cocktail Top 10 Hotel Bars internationally.
Tip: Entry through the hotel lobby and down the stairs; walk-in possible early in the week, book Fri-Sat. Cash plus card.
AnonymouS Bar ★ 4.4
€€stare-mestoMon-Thu 17:00-02:00, Fri-Sat 17:00-03:00, Sun 17:00-02:00
AnonymouS Bar runs an Old Town room themed around V for Vendetta and the Guy Fawkes mask, with masked bartenders, a UV menu that reveals hidden cocktails under blacklight and a vaulted Gothic-Renaissance space off Michalská. Won Czech Bar Awards for design and cocktail programme in 2013.
Tip: Ask for the UV torch to read the hidden menu; small tables turn fast. Cash plus card.
L'Fleur ★ 4.5
€€€stare-mestoSun-Thu 18:00-02:00, Fri-Sat 18:00-03:00
L'Fleur sits on V Kolkovně in the Old Town with exposed brick, dark wood and stained-glass elements, and is the first official Champagne-region partner bar in the Czech Republic. The list runs classic cocktails plus a long Champagne and signature programme.
Tip: Champagne flights are the bar's signature; the booths at the back are the date-night seat. Cash plus card.
Friends Club ★ 4.1
€stare-mestoDaily 21:00-06:00
Friends has run from a Bartolomějská cellar in the Old Town since the mid-1990s, with three floors, a small dance floor and a weekly rotation of karaoke, drag, oldies and themed nights. The crowd reads queer-leaning but cross-tourist.
Tip: Tuesday karaoke and Thursday drag are the packed nights. Cash easier than card; ATM on site.
Vzorkovna (Dog Bar) ★ 4.0
€stare-mestoDaily 18:00-05:00 approx
Vzorkovna runs as Prague's reference underground dive, a labyrinth of low-vaulted rooms under Národní with mismatched furniture, a foosball table, a small live music room and several resident dogs roaming between the bars. Payment is loaded onto a bracelet at the door.
Tip: Load the bracelet with what you plan to spend; unused credit is non-refundable. The room peaks 23:00 onward.
